DescriptionLower margin reads: "London. Pub.d Nov.r 28th 1791 by H. Humphrey N.o 18 Old Bond Street/ FRYING SPRATS_,/ Vide. Royal Supper./ "Ah! sure a pair was never seen,"
Label TextThe Queen, much caricatured, sits over a fire in profile to the right, toasting sprats on a gridiron (then called a saveall): a plate of fish stands on a high trivet beside her. She wears over-sleeves, a check apron over an under-petticoat on which hangs a pocket, bulging with guineas, but patched. This is one of the many attacks on the King and Queen for miserliness.
